The DRC is scaling up Ebola diagnostic tests, but experts warn this alone isn't enough. A comprehensive approach is needed to truly combat the threat.

The notion that a potent disease outbreak can be swiftly contained by simply increasing diagnostic tests is a dangerous oversimplification. While crucial, enhanced testing capacity in the Democratic Republic of Congo (DRC) for the Ebola virus is merely one facet of a much larger, more complex battle against infectious diseases, a battle increasingly complicated by competing global health demands and strained resources. The World Health Organization (WHO), in collaboration with the DRC's national medical research institute, has indeed announced a significant ramp-up of diagnostic capabilities. This initiative, detailed through official channels including social media platform X, aims to bolster the country's ability to detect and respond to potential Ebola cases more rapidly. For a nation that has weathered multiple devastating Ebola epidemics, this is a critical, albeit familiar, step. The urgency is underscored by past experiences, such as the 2014-2016 West Africa outbreak, which tragically claimed over 11,300 lives, a stark reminder of the virus's devastating potential when containment efforts falter. However, the effectiveness of this diagnostic surge hinges on a robust and interconnected public health infrastructure that extends far beyond the laboratory. It requires well-trained healthcare workers on the front lines, efficient contact tracing mechanisms, secure cold chains for sample transport, and community engagement strategies built on trust. Without these foundational elements, even the most advanced testing kits can become bottlenecks, leading to delays in isolation, treatment, and ultimately, wider community spread. The DRC's vast and challenging geography, coupled with ongoing security concerns in some regions, further complicates the logistical and operational aspects of a comprehensive response. Dr. Anya Sharma, a global health security analyst not directly involved with the current WHO initiative but an expert on epidemic preparedness, cautions against viewing increased testing in isolation. "Diagnostic capacity is a vital early warning system, but it's not the entire security apparatus," she stated in a recent interview. "Without parallel investments in outbreak investigation teams, rapid response units, and crucially, sustained community dialogue and education, the diagnostic tools themselves can generate false confidence. We've seen in previous outbreaks that the weakest links in the chain are often human and systemic, not technological." The broader impact of such preparedness measures in the DRC reverberates globally. As a nation situated in a region prone to zoonotic spillover events, strengthening its health security is not just a national imperative but a matter of international public health. Lessons learned and capacities built in the DRC can serve as a model, or a warning, for other vulnerable nations. Conversely, any sliver of weakness in the DRC's defenses represents a potential breach that could allow a pathogen to traverse borders, underscoring the interconnectedness of global health security in an era of rapid travel and trade. Furthermore, the DRC's ongoing efforts to bolster Ebola response occur against a backdrop of shifting global health priorities. The COVID-19 pandemic irrevocably altered funding streams and international attention, often diverting resources and expertise away from other critical infectious disease threats, including those endemic to regions like Central Africa. While the world was engrossed in the pandemic, neglected tropical diseases and established threats like Ebola continued to require vigilance and investment. This current push for enhanced Ebola diagnostics in the DRC can be seen as an attempt to reassert focus on these persistent dangers. Specific figures highlight the scale of the challenge. The DRC's Ministry of Health has historically operated with limited budgets, often relying heavily on international aid for major public health campaigns. Securing sustained, predictable funding for not just emergency responses but also for ongoing surveillance, training, and infrastructure maintenance remains a perpetual struggle. Past outbreaks have seen substantial influxes of international funding during the crisis, which often dwindled once the immediate threat subsided, leaving a legacy of underfunded preparedness. Looking ahead, the success of the current diagnostic scale-up will be measured not just by the number of tests conducted, but by its tangible impact on containment timelines and reduced mortality. Observers will be watching closely for evidence of how effectively these enhanced capabilities are integrated into broader response strategies, the level of sustained international and national financial commitment, and the continued engagement with local communities. The true test lies in whether this renewed focus translates into a more resilient and responsive public health system capable of weathering future storms, whether they be Ebola or another emergent threat. The capacity to swiftly identify and isolate cases is, without doubt, a cornerstone of effective epidemic control. However, this vital step is but one component within a far more intricate system of public health defenses. The current efforts in the Democratic Republic of Congo to amplify its Ebola diagnostic capabilities, while commendable and necessary, must be viewed within the wider context of systemic preparedness, community trust, and the ever-present challenge of competing global health imperatives. The long-term implications of strengthening health infrastructure in a high-risk region like the DRC extend beyond immediate outbreak control. It contributes to global health security by reducing the likelihood of international spread, while also providing a blueprint for other nations facing similar threats. The success of this initiative, therefore, is not solely a Congolese concern; it is a critical indicator of our collective ability to manage the persistent and evolving landscape of infectious disease threats in the 21st century.
